Digital Code Enter
Trendy key chopping machines typically make use of digital code enter. This permits operators to enter a key’s bitting data straight into the machine, bypassing the necessity for a bodily key unique in sure situations. This characteristic considerably accelerates the duplication course of and reduces the prospect of errors related to handbook interpretation of key cuts. For instance, a locksmith can duplicate a misplaced automotive key by accessing the car’s key code database and inputting the code into the machine.
-
Automated Reducing Cycles
As soon as the important thing data is enter, automated chopping cycles take over. The machine routinely positions the important thing clean, initiates the chopping course of, and completes the duplication with out handbook intervention. This exact management minimizes variations in chopping depth and angle, resulting in extra correct key duplicates. That is significantly useful when duplicating complicated keys, equivalent to these with inside cuts or intricate milling patterns.

Restricted Key Blanks
Many high-security key methods make the most of restricted key blanks, that means the blanks themselves will not be available for buy with out correct authorization. Key chopping machines designed for these methods typically incorporate options that forestall duplication utilizing unauthorized or generic key blanks. This restriction limits the potential for unauthorized key creation, enhancing total safety. For instance, some machines require a particular code or authorization card earlier than accepting a restricted key clean for duplication.
-
Consumer Authentication and Entry Management
Trendy key chopping machines typically incorporate person authentication options, requiring operators to log in with credentials earlier than accessing key duplication functionalities. This entry management prevents unauthorized people from utilizing the machine and helps monitor key duplication exercise. As an example, some machines use fingerprint scanners or PIN codes to confirm operator id, guaranteeing solely licensed personnel can duplicate keys. This audit path enhances accountability and assists in investigations of potential safety breaches.

Ideas for Optimum Key Reducing Machine Operation
Sustaining optimum efficiency and lengthening the lifespan of key chopping tools requires adherence to greatest practices. The next ideas present steering for attaining constant, correct key duplication and minimizing operational challenges.
Tip 1: Common Blade Upkeep
Reducing blade sharpness straight impacts the precision and high quality of key duplicates. Implement an everyday blade sharpening or substitute schedule primarily based on utilization frequency and producer suggestions. Uninteresting blades exert extreme drive, resulting in imprecise cuts and elevated put on on the machine.
Tip 2: Correct Machine Calibration
Common calibration ensures constant accuracy. Calibration procedures, typically outlined within the person handbook, compensate for put on and tear on machine parts, sustaining exact alignment and chopping depth.
Tip 3: Acceptable Key Clean Choice
Utilizing the proper key clean for the precise key sort is important. Mismatched blanks can result in inaccurate cuts, broken keys, and even harm to the machine. Seek the advice of key clean catalogs or producer specs for correct clean choice.
Tip 4: Safe Clamping Methods
Securely clamping the important thing clean prevents motion throughout chopping, guaranteeing correct duplication. Use the suitable clamps and alter clamping strain primarily based on the important thing clean materials and thickness.
Tip 5: Cleanliness and Lubrication
Common cleansing removes steel shavings and particles that may intrude with the machine’s operation. Lubricate shifting elements based on the producer’s suggestions to cut back friction and put on.
Tip 6: Environmental Concerns
Function the machine in a steady setting, avoiding excessive temperatures or extreme humidity. Fluctuations in temperature and humidity can have an effect on machine efficiency and calibration.
